The Pros of Choosing Spray Foam Insulation Experts in Newberry
1. Enhanced Energy Efficiency
One of the top reasons homeowners in Newberry opt for spray foam insulation is its exceptional energy efficiency. Unlike traditional insulation materials like fiberglass, spray foam expands upon application, filling gaps and crevices that are hard to reach. This airtight seal prevents heat from escaping during the winter and blocks heat from entering during the summer, helping you maintain a comfortable temperature year-round. Spray foam’s superior air-sealing properties can lead to significant savings on energy bills, especially in a region like Newberry, where temperature fluctuations are common.
2. Improved Indoor Air Quality
Spray foam insulation also contributes to better indoor air quality. By sealing cracks, gaps, and other openings, spray foam prevents the infiltration of outdoor allergens, pollutants, and moisture. This is particularly beneficial for homeowners in Newberry who may be dealing with seasonal pollen, dust, or humidity-related issues. Additionally, spray foam insulation can help reduce mold growth by keeping moisture from entering the home, creating a healthier living environment.
3. Long-Term Durability
When installed properly, spray foam insulation can last for decades. Unlike fiberglass or cellulose insulation, spray foam does not sag or settle over time. It maintains its shape and effectiveness, ensuring that the energy efficiency benefits persist for years. For homeowners in Newberry, this durability can result in long-term savings and fewer maintenance needs, making it a worthwhile investment.
4. Soundproofing Benefits
Spray foam insulation is not only effective at controlling temperature but also helps in reducing noise. The dense structure of spray foam helps to dampen sound transmission, making it an excellent choice for those who want to minimize external noise or prevent sound from traveling between rooms in their homes. This can be particularly useful for homes located near busy streets or for those who live in shared buildings in Newberry.

The Cons of Choosing Spray Foam Insulation Experts in Newberry
While there are many benefits to choosing spray foam insulation experts in Newberry, there are also a few drawbacks to consider before making a decision.
1. Higher Initial Costs
One of the main downsides of spray foam insulation is its upfront cost. Although it offers long-term savings on energy bills, spray foam insulation can be more expensive to install than other types of insulation. Homeowners in Newberry may find the initial investment to be higher compared to traditional fiberglass or cellulose insulation. However, it’s important to factor in the potential for future energy savings and the increased value spray foam can bring to your property.
2. Requires Professional Installation
Spray foam insulation requires specialized equipment and expertise to apply correctly. Improper installation can lead to gaps, uneven coverage, or even air leaks that reduce its effectiveness. Choosing the right spray foam insulation experts in Newberry is essential to ensuring the insulation is applied correctly. It’s also important to make sure that the installer adheres to safety protocols, as improper application can result in health and safety concerns.
3. Potential Odor and Off-Gassing
Although spray foam insulation is generally safe, some people may be sensitive to the odors or chemicals released during the installation process. The smell of freshly applied foam can be strong and unpleasant, though it typically dissipates after a few hours or days. It’s crucial to ensure that the installation area is properly ventilated and that the products used are of high quality to minimize any potential health risks.
4. Limited Reusability and Difficulty in Removal
While spray foam insulation is durable, it can be challenging to remove or replace if necessary. If you need to modify the structure of your home or remove the insulation for any reason, spray foam can be difficult to work with. Unlike traditional insulation, which can be pulled out or replaced, spray foam becomes a permanent part of your home’s structure once applied, making future changes more complicated.
5. Specialized Maintenance
Though spray foam insulation requires minimal maintenance, it’s important to have it inspected periodically by experts to ensure that it continues to perform at its best. In some cases, damage or wear can occur over time, especially in areas that experience extreme weather conditions, like Newberry. Regular checks and maintenance from professionals will help address any issues before they become more costly or require extensive repairs.

FAQ: Common Questions About Spray Foam Insulation
1. How much does spray foam insulation cost in Newberry?
Spray foam insulation can be more expensive than traditional insulation materials, with prices varying based on the size of the area to be insulated and the type of foam used. However, the long-term savings in energy bills can make it a worthwhile investment.
2. How long does spray foam insulation last?
Spray foam insulation can last 20-30 years or longer when properly installed and maintained. Its durability makes it an excellent long-term solution for homeowners.
3. Can spray foam insulation help with soundproofing?
Yes, spray foam insulation is effective at reducing sound transmission, making it an excellent choice for homes in noisy areas or for creating quieter spaces within the home.
4. Is spray foam insulation safe?
When installed by professionals, spray foam insulation is safe and effective. However, improper installation can lead to health risks, so it’s important to hire qualified experts for the job.
5. Can I install spray foam insulation myself?
While some DIY spray foam kits are available, it is highly recommended to hire a professional to ensure proper application. Improper installation can lead to gaps and reduced effectiveness.
